Two names were missing to have the complete #TeamEurope for this upcoming Laver Cup 2024. Two names were announced this very morning, names that we are already familiar with from past editions. They are the Norwegian Casper Ruud and the Greek Stefanos Tsitsipas, both regulars in the competition and also part of the world's top 10. They will join the previously selected players, such as Carlos Alcaraz, Daniil Medvedev, Alexander Zverev, and, of course, Rafa Nadal. All of them will seek to reverse the trend of the last two editions, which ended with victory for #TeamWorld.

After leaving behind a brief grass court tour, where he only played two matches at Wimbledon, we can say that Casper Ruud was smiling again this week as he stepped back onto the clay. However, this morning, Thiago Monteiro crossed his path to wipe that smile off his face. It was a victory for the Brazilian in the round of 16 of the ATP 250 in Bastad, knocking out the second seed in the draw (6-3, 6-3), although we will still see the Norwegian teaming up with Rafa Nadal in the doubles discipline. On the other hand, Monteiro is having an outstanding season, having already defeated Stefanos Tsitsipas at the last Madrid Masters 1000.

So much time had passed that he had even forgotten the feeling of what it was like to win a match on grass. His friend Benoit Paire has done it again, five years later, he won an official grass-court match at the ATP 250 in Newport, the iconic American tournament that always closes the grass season. There stood the Frenchman, at 35 years old and outside the top 200, to defeat Zachary Svajda in the first round (6-3, 3-6, 7-6) and claim his second official victory of the season, with the first one dating back to early February. We will see if it's a coincidence or if Benoit has much more serious intentions this week.

Rafael Nadal has not yet confirmed when or where he will retire this year. What seems clear is that it will not be after the Paris Olympic Games, which begin on July 27, as the Spanish player is listed in the US Open Entry List using a protected ranking. Therefore, the four-time champion of the tournament would return to New York after his absence last year due to injury. Despite there being still a month and a half before the last Grand Slam of the season and anything can change at any moment, Nadal wants to once again compete on the hard courts of New York.

At the age of 39, Stan Wawrinka continues to seek sensations along a circuit that is no longer giving him any ease. The Swiss, who has not won two consecutive matches since the US Open 2023, approached this week with great enthusiasm for the ATP 250 Gstaad, although unfortunately for his interests, he could not advance past the debut. Defeated in the first round by Lukas Klein (7-6, 2-6, 7-5), everything indicates that the Swiss player is getting closer to the end each day. Hopefully, we are wrong.

The name of Fabian Marozsan always poses a danger in any circuit frame, especially when it comes to a first round. This time, the poisoned draw fell on Holger Rune at the ATP 500 in Hamburg, where he serves as the second seed. The Dane handled his debut well with a score of 6-4 and 6-4 to advance further in the competition and set up a match in the round of 16 with the Argentine, Trungelliti. Tomorrow, we will see the top title favorite in action, local player Alexander Zverev.
